solaris compile error: resource.h:146: error: field ‘ru_utime’ has incomplete type #472

Open GoogleCodeExporter opened 8 years ago

GoogleCodeExporter commented 8 years ago
Hi, 

What version of Redis you are using, in what kind of Operating System?
redis-1.2.6, redis-2.0.4, redis-2.2.0, redis-2.2.1
root@comp:~ # uname -a
SunOS comp 5.10 Generic_127128-11 i86pc i386 i86pc Solaris

What is the problem you are experiencing?
* make error:
What is the expected output? What do you see instead?
In file included from /usr/include/sys/vnode.h:45,
                 from /usr/include/sys/stream.h:22,
                 from /usr/include/netinet/in.h:66,
                 from /usr/include/sys/socket.h:45,
                 from anet.c:34:
/usr/include/sys/resource.h:146: error: field ‘ru_utime’ has incomplete type
/usr/include/sys/resource.h:147: error: field ‘ru_stime’ has incomplete type
make[1]: *** [anet.o] Error 1
make: *** [32bit] Error 2

What steps will reproduce the problem?
* download any redis version, try to compile on SunOS 5.10

Please provide any additional information below.
root@comp:~ # gcc --version
gcc (GCC) 4.3.4

this is a duplicate of: http://code.google.com/p/redis/issues/detail?id=90
but that issue is closed.

Hello,

I experienced a similar problem when I learned the default build was 32-bit on 
the Sun Solaris 10 platform.

Follows may be a fix, to include $(ARCH) in CFLAGS definition for SunOS (line 
16 of src/Makefile in TRUNK):

--- redis-2.4.0-rc7/src/Makefile.orig   Mon Sep 12 06:13:44 2011
+++ redis-2.4.0-rc7/src/Makefile        Mon Sep 12 21:41:57 2011
@@ -25,7 +25,7 @@
 endif

 ifeq ($(uname_S),SunOS)
-  CFLAGS?=-std=c99 -pedantic $(OPTIMIZATION) -Wall -W -D__EXTENSIONS__ -D_XPG6
+  CFLAGS?=-std=c99 -pedantic $(OPTIMIZATION) -Wall -W -D__EXTENSIONS__ -D_XPG6 
$(ARCH)
   CCLINK?=-ldl -lnsl -lsocket -lm -lpthread
   DEBUG?=-g -ggdb
 else

That is, if you were attempting, directly or not, a 64-bit compile.

I myself ran into your issue mid-way of achieving a 64-bit compile on SunOs. It 
appears to be improper PATH, CFLAGS, LDFLAGS. The timeval data type seems 
uncertain when incorrect 64-bit flag combinations are used.

For 64-bit binary, given gcc in /usr/local/bin, it seems necessary to override 
CFLAGS to include -m64 for the linking stage, otherwise:

cc -c -std=c99 -pedantic -O2 -Wall -W -D__EXTENSIONS__ -D_XPG6 -m64 -g -ggdb 
ae.c
    CC ae.o
cc -c -std=c99 -pedantic -O2 -Wall -W -D__EXTENSIONS__ -D_XPG6 
-I../deps/hiredis -g -ggdb
    CC redis-benchmark.o
cc -o redis-benchmark -std=c99 -pedantic -O2 -Wall -W -D__EXTENSIONS__ -D_XPG6 
-m64 -g -ggdb ae.o anet.o redis-benchmark.o sds.o adlist.o zmalloc.o 
../deps/hiredis/libhiredis.a -ldl -lnsl -lsocket -lm -lpthread
    LINK redis-benchmark
ld: fatal: file ae.o: wrong ELF class: ELFCLASS32

because in src/Makefile,
158: redis-benchmark.o:
159:        $(QUIET_CC)$(CC) -c $(CFLAGS) -I../deps/hiredis $(DEBUG) 
$(COMPILE_TIME) $<

Only $(CFLAGS) is defined here as an argument to $(CC) for linking 
redis-benchmark.o I believe $(ARCH) should also be passed here, above is a 
patch to rectify that issue.

Without the patch, you may set an explicit CFLAGS,

$ export PATH=/usr/local/bin:/usr/sfw/bin:/usr/bin:/usr/sbin:/usr/ccs/bin
$ CFLAGS='-std=c99 -pedantic $(OPTIMIZATION) -Wall -W -D__EXTENSIONS__ -D_XPG6 
-m64' LDFLAGS='-m64' gmake ARCH='-m64'

and it builds successfully.

With the patch, both 32-bit (default, no arguments to gmake) and 64-bit builds 
(with make argument ARCH='-m64') build successfully.

$ file src/redis-server
src/redis-server:       ELF 64-bit MSB executable SPARCV9 Version 1, 
dynamically linked, not stripped

=

Using,
$ gmake ARCH="-m64" OPTIMIZATION="-O3"

increased redis-benchmark overall realtime by 1s, from ~6 to ~5 on 
UltraSPARC-T2+ 1415 Mhz Sun Blade T6340.
